引言
微信小程序自推出以来,以其便捷性和易用性迅速占领了移动应用市场。作为一个16岁的孩子,你可能对如何从零开始搭建一个微信小程序充满好奇。本文将带你一步步深入了解微信小程序的搭建过程,从基础入门到高级应用,让你成为微信小程序的高手。
第一章:微信小程序简介
1.1 什么是微信小程序?
微信小程序是一种不需要下载安装即可使用的应用,它实现了应用“触手可及”的理念,用户扫一扫或搜一下即可打开应用。
1.2 小程序的优势
- 开发成本低:无需开发原生应用,可以节省大量开发成本。
- 用户获取简单:依托微信庞大的用户群体,易于获取用户。
- 更新迅速:无需经过应用商店审核,更新速度快。
第二章:入门准备
2.1 开发环境搭建
要开发微信小程序,首先需要准备以下环境:
- 微信开发者工具:提供代码编辑、调试等功能。
- Node.js环境:用于运行小程序开发依赖。
- Git:用于代码版本控制。
2.2 学习资源
- 官方文档:微信小程序官方文档提供了最权威的学习资料。
- 在线教程:网络上有许多优秀的微信小程序教程,适合初学者。
第三章:小程序架构
3.1 页面结构
微信小程序的基本页面结构包括:
- WXML:用于描述页面结构。
- WXSS:用于描述页面样式。
- JavaScript:用于描述页面逻辑。
3.2 组件
微信小程序提供了丰富的组件库,包括视图容器、基础内容、表单组件、导航等。
第四章:从零开始搭建小程序
4.1 创建小程序
在微信开发者工具中创建一个新的小程序项目,填写项目信息。
4.2 编写页面
创建一个简单的页面,包括WXML、WXSS和JavaScript文件。
4.3 调试与运行
在微信开发者工具中调试代码,并在手机上预览效果。
第五章:进阶技巧
5.1 优化性能
- 代码优化:减少不必要的DOM操作,使用缓存等技术。
- 资源优化:压缩图片、音频等资源。
5.2 接口调用
微信小程序提供了丰富的API,可以调用微信提供的接口,如支付、分享等。
5.3 小程序云开发
微信小程序云开发可以帮助开发者快速搭建后端服务。
第六章:实战案例
6.1 开发一个简单的购物车小程序
通过实际案例,学习如何实现购物车功能。
6.2 开发一个音乐播放器小程序
学习如何使用微信小程序的音频API实现音乐播放功能。
第七章:总结与展望
7.1 总结
通过本文的学习,相信你已经对微信小程序有了更深入的了解。
7.2 展望
随着微信小程序生态的不断发展,未来将有更多的可能性等待我们去探索。
结语
微信小程序作为移动应用开发的新趋势,具有广阔的发展前景。希望本文能帮助你从入门到精通,成为一名优秀的微信小程序开发者。
